Is Oakstown not safe anymore? That’s what the Oakstown mayor thinks in Domino Effect 5 The Fallout of Oakstown. One night the Oakstown Hospital took care of many pregnant women while the mayor made an announcement on the TV that Oakstown isn’t safe anymore and will be blown up and irradiated. Twenty-three years later, the mother who saw this main premonition, Maggie Ivey; her son Thomas Ivey is going on a trip to what once was Oakstown with seven of his friends. But instead of Maggie having these visions, it is her son who is having these visions. While these eight people go back to Oakstown for the trip, they all start to die off one by one in the order they would have died. But how is this even possible since they weren’t even born yet? How is it not Maggie and the other mothers who are supposed to be dying? And most importantly, how will each of these people fare on this radioactive trip? Well the book explains all of that.
